Output 3c1f4c18656b5e66fe68d9c229aaa85a347be21dc37f4cda83c33fc64d45c246:0

value
899322
script pubkey
OP_0 OP_PUSHBYTES_20 8b5a84648ce10d65307bcdcdfa12ef8d2bbf3ecb
address
bc1q3ddggeyvuyxk2vrmehxl5yh0354m70ktdmdsvc
transaction
3c1f4c18656b5e66fe68d9c229aaa85a347be21dc37f4cda83c33fc64d45c246
confirmations
131628
spent
true